Hyperiidea

...A general term for small crustaceans of the Hyperiidea suborder of amphipods that live a purely planktonic life in the ocean, or a species of the family Medusa. Medusa generally have large eyes that occupy most of the head.

From 【Amphipoda】

…They are classified into four suborders: Gammaridea (shrimps, sandhoppers), Ingolphiellidea (mainly deep-sea), Hyperiidea (jellyfish, fleas), and Caprellidea (caprellidea). [Shigeo Gamou]. …
